Pro tip from the manual: If your process cannot tolerate large temperature swings (e.g., a biological incubator), you cannot run Auto-tune live. Instead, set At = 2 for a gentler, slightly less optimized cycle, or tune manually using the Ziegler-Nichols method.

Thermocouple: Connect the positive wire to Terminal 9 and the negative wire to Terminal 10.

For Relay Output: Terminal 3 (Normally Open), Terminal 4 (Common), Terminal 5 (Normally Closed).
